This position will be hired at either a Senior or Staff level Engineer position.
We are seeking a highly skilled and motivated Engineer to join our team. The Engineer will be responsible for DER Interconnection Studies and Engineering, as well as supporting the planning, coordinating, and overseeing distributed energy resource (DER) projects including, including but not limited to Energy Storage, with a focus on grid-edge technologies projects from inception to completion. Those responsibilities include but are not limited to developing, implementing, and managing various engineering projects. This role combines expertise in power systems, systems protection, renewable energy, energy storage, and advanced grid integration to deliver innovative solutions.
The engineer will review and analyze grid requirements, the effectiveness and efficiency of existing systems and develop strategies for improving and further leveraging these systems. Develop and interpret organizational goals, policies, and procedures. Review project strategies to plan and coordinate project activity. Stay abreast of advances in technology, working with internal and external stakeholders, to identify additional projects and partnerships in furtherance of the DEV objectives.
This role requires a strong technical background, excellent project management skills, and the ability to work collaboratively with cross-functional teams.

REQUIRED ENGINEERING CRITERIA: For placement of a candidate in the Engineer job series, the following criteria must be met: Possess a 4-year Engineering degree from an ABET accredited Engineering program based on the year that the Engineering program was accredited by ABET, or Possess a 4-year Engineering degree from an institution outside of the U.S. which is accredited through the country's own Engineering accrediting body under the Washington Accord as a full signatory, and is a degree that was recognized by the country's accrediting body on or after the date that full signatory status was achieved, or Possess a 4-year degree in Engineering (non-ABET accredited), Physics, Chemistry, Math or Engineering Technology and a post-graduate Engineering degree from an institution where the undergraduate degree in the same Engineering discipline is ABET-accredited based on the year the Engineering program was accredited by ABET, or Holds or has previously held a valid U.S. Professional Engineer license.
